The New Jersey Office of the Attorney General is investigating a deadly crash in Woodbridge.
The attorney general says that a Woodbridge police officer was trying to pull over a Nissan Maxima on Route 1 just before midnight on Feb. 19, but the driver of that car sped off. Officials say that Nissan then crashed into a separate vehicle near Gill Lane.
The passenger in the Nissan was critically injured in the crash and was pronounced dead at 12:25 a.m. Officials say all other people involved in the crash were seriously injured and taken to Robert Wood Johnson Medical Center for treatment. They also say tha ta dead dog was found inside the Nissan.
No police officers were injured.
Route 1 was closed for a time in the area but has since reopened.
The names of the people involved in the incident have not yet been released.
